Ending all speculations BJP has fielded former Chief Minister Biplab Kumar Deb as the party’s Rajya Sabha candidate. The election to the lone seat that fell vacant following resignation of incumbent Rajya Sabha member Dr Manik Saha will t ake place on September 22 next.
Chief Minister Dr. Manik Sahaand other party leaders congratulated Deb for being nominated as the Rajya Sabha member
Deb’s fight will be against opposition Left front candidate former minister Bhanu Lal Saha who also fought against Dr Saha in the previous RS polls.
On Friday two important decisions were taken in regards to Deb. First he was made the party’s in-charge of Haryana Pradesh and then at 11.48 pm at night he was made the Rajya Sabha candidate.
Deb who was in Delhi would be returning Agartala on Saturday evening.
Sources said, Prime Minister Narendra Modi held former Chief Minister had a meeting with him. There were also meetings with other party functionaries like party president JP Nadda and others.
The nomination to Rajya Sabha came at a time when there were speculations about Deb’s political position since his resignation from the Chief Minister’s post.
Apart from making Deb as in charge of Hariyana also made MP Dr. Mahesh Sharma as Prabhari for Tripura.
Dr. Sharma has replaced Vinod Sonkar as the state BJP observer. Sonkar was given charge of Daman and Diu and Dadra and Nagar Haveli.
According to party sources, it is an important move as the state would go to assembly polls in the next few months.
